FrontView REIT, Inc. (NYSE:FVR) Given Consensus Rating of “Hold” by Analysts

FrontView REIT, Inc. (NYSE:FVRGet Free Report) has earned a consensus recommendation of “Hold” from the eight analysts that are covering the stock, MarketBeat.com reports. Two research analysts have rated the stock with a sell recommendation, three have assigned a hold recommendation, two have issued a buy recommendation and one has issued a strong buy recommendation on the company. The average 12-month price target among brokerages that have covered the stock in the last year is $16.5833.

Several research analysts recently weighed in on FVR shares. JPMorgan Chase & Co. upped their price objective on shares of FrontView REIT from $15.00 to $17.00 and gave the stock a “neutral” rating in a research report on Monday, December 8th. Morgan Stanley boosted their price target on shares of FrontView REIT from $13.50 to $14.00 and gave the stock an “equal weight” rating in a research note on Wednesday, December 31st. B. Riley Financial started coverage on shares of FrontView REIT in a report on Thursday, March 19th. They issued a “buy” rating and a $20.50 price target on the stock. Weiss Ratings restated a “sell (d)” rating on shares of FrontView REIT in a research report on Friday, March 27th. Finally, Zacks Research downgraded shares of FrontView REIT from a “strong-bu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a report on Monday, March 9th.

FrontView REIT Trading Down 0.4%

Shares of FVR stock opened at $15.46 on Friday. The stock has a market capitalization of $344.98 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-70.29, a PEG ratio of 1.97 and a beta of 1.20. The company’s fifty day simple moving average is $16.12 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$15.11. FrontView REIT has a 1 year low of $10.61 and a 1 year high of $17.09.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.64, a current ratio of 0.73 and a quick ratio of 0.73.

FrontView REIT (NYSE:FVRG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Tuesday, February 24th. The company reported ($0.19) ear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.31 by ($0.50). The company had revenue of $16.52 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$16.94 million. FrontView REIT had a negative net margin of 5.71% and a negative return on equity of 0.76%. FrontView REIT has set its FY 2026 guidance at 1.270-1.320 EPS. As a group, analysts anticipate that FrontView REIT will post 1.22 earnings per share for the current year.

FrontView REIT Announces Dividend

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, April 15th. Shareholders of record on Tuesday, March 31st will be paid a dividend of $0.215 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Tuesday, March 31st. This represents a $0.86 annualized dividend and a yield of 5.6%. FrontView REIT’s payout ratio is -390.91%.
